Implementation Tactics for CPOs Establish a value-driven operating model Design an operating model that integrates category management, supplier relationship management, and governance with clear accountability. This structure supports rapid decision making and durable performance improvements. Embed advanced analytics to reveal cost-to-serve, total cost of ownership, and value leakage across the source-to-pay cycle. Digital transformation and data integration Accelerate end-to-end process digitization, linking internal data with external market signals to enable real-time insights and proactive risk management. Leverage AI-enabled tools for contract analytics, spend visibility, and supplier risk scoring to strengthen decision quality and resilience. Supplier ecosystem resilience Diversify supplier bases and build agile sourcing protocols to mitigate disruptions and preserve supply continuity under dynamic conditions. Implement digital supplier collaboration platforms that improve transparency, performance tracking, and risk mitigation across networks.
